Is the Barber College Accredited? It's essential to make sure that the barber college you enroll in is accredited. The accreditation should be by a U.S. Department of Education certified local or national organization, such as the National Accrediting Commission for Cosmetology Arts & Sciences (NACCAS). Schools accredited by the NACCAS must measure up to their high standards assuring a superior curriculum and education. Accreditation may also be necessary for obtaining student loans or financial aid, which frequently are not obtainable in Palm Springs FL for non- accredited schools. It's also a requirement for licensing in some states that the training be accredited. And as a concluding benefit, many businesses will not employ recent graduates of non-accredited schools, or might look more positively upon those with accredited training.

Is Any Live Training Provided?  Learning and mastering barbering skills and techniques demands lots of practice on people. Find out how much live, hands-on training is furnished in the barber courses you will be attending. A number of schools have shops on site that make it possible for students to practice their developing skills on volunteers. If a Palm Springs FL barber school furnishes minimal or no scheduled live training, but rather depends mainly on using mannequins, it may not be the best alternative for cultivating your skills. Therefore look for other schools that provide this kind of training.

Does the School have a Job Placement Program?  As soon as a student graduates from a barber school, it's essential that she or he gets support in securing that very first job. Job placement programs are an integral part of that process. Schools that furnish help develop relationships with local businesses that are looking for skilled graduates available for hiring. Verify that the programs you are considering have job placement programs and inquire which Palm Springs FL area shops and businesses they refer students to. Also, find out what their job placement rates are. Higher rates not only verify that they have broad networks of employers, but that their programs are highly regarded as well.

Is Financial Aid Offered?  Most barber schools provide financial aid or student loan assistance for their students. Ask if the schools you are looking at have a financial aid department. Talk to a counselor and learn what student loans or grants you may get approved for. If the school is a member of the American Association of Cosmetology Schools (AACS), it will have scholarships accessible to students too. If a school meets each of your other qualifications with the exception of cost, do not discard it as an option before you determine what financial aid may be provided in Palm Springs FL.
